Tuesday, December 4, 1990
The
National Assembly of Bulgaria
elects
Dimitar Iliev Popov
as
Prime Minister of Bulgaria
.
Saddam Hussein
releases the Western hostages.
President of Bangladesh
Hussain Muhammad Ershad
resigns he is replaced by
Shahabuddin Ahmed
, who becomes interim president.
In
Brussels
, trade talks break fail because of a dispute between the U.S. and the
European Union
over farm export subsidies.
President Hossain Mohammad Ershad of Bangladesh is forced to resign following massive protests.
Lech Wałęsa wins the 2nd round of Poland's first presidential election.
Slobodan Milošević
becomes President of
Serbia
.
